REPORT: Palestinian students compete for prestigious Hult Prize
Students from from the Palestinian Territories have taken part in the annual international Hult Prize for the second year in a row.
 
 Eleven university teams competed in the first stage of the annual international competition.

The 2017 Hult Prize is themed “Refugees - Reawakening Human Potential” focusing on restoring the rights and dignity of 10 million refugees by 2022.

The competition organized by the Clinton Global Initiative and the Hult International Business School, will secure a one million dollar investment in the winning startup.

Competitors gathered in a small hall to present their social enterprise idea to a panel of five judges.

A group of architectural students from the Bezalel Academy of Arts and Design in Jerusalem made it through to the second stage.
